The Manthan Digital Bazaar will showcase 100+ best innovative digital
innovations LIVE with a focus on scaling up communities such as NGOs,
Community Radio, NGOs, Wireless & broadband and Social media startups.
It is a platform created with an objective to provide an opportunity to all best
identied ICT innovations across various regions of Asia Pacic to network and
ideate on ICT evolution for development.

Mathan Digital Inclusion Film Festival is being organized to give recognition to
creative and innovative people, bringing stories of change, hope, empowerment and
awareness.
With a growing online presence of innovative storytelling through moving images,
Manthan DIFF is providing an opportunity to screen lms related to development,
usage, and impact of digital tools such as community media, TV, radio, internet, and
mobile phones on masses.
The objectives behind Digital Inclusion Film Festival are:
Ÿ
Bringing creative minds and change makers together for potential collaboration
Introducing different cultures, social ethos and challenges that each country,
region, state faces while using ICT tools.
Creating a common platform for lmmakers from across the subcontinent to
project excellence in lmmaking, appreciation of lm cultures, techniques and
ideas.

Summit Focus
The Summit will focus on economical and rightful access to communication
infrastructure to ensure social inclusion of marginalized communities and women
Summit Objectives
Ÿ
Ÿ
Ÿ
Ÿ
To identify the regulatory and legal challenges in obtaining affordable high-speed
infrastructure from the Government
To understand gaps in ICT literacy and skills of local people and challenges for
capacity building to ensure social inclusion in the digital world
To identify challenges in overcoming the language barrier responsible for the
digital divide
To nd ways to engage the community and other stakeholders to build locally
relevant applications for the Community Networks
